Secure executive support

First, you’ll present to your project team for their input and feedback.
Next, prepare your change management proposal to present to an
executive sponsor or leadership group.
In most organizations, your executive sponsor is usually the IT Director,
CIO, or CTO—someone with authority to promote change management.
The team will have a respected, authoritative name to back up the
mission, and will speak to it as part of the company’s strategy.
In your presentation and discussions with your executive sponsor, you’ll
focus on securing:

Support for your change management approach—does this fit
with your company culture and organization?

Commitment to internal and external resources/funding.

Agreement on the executive sponsor to be a visible leader of change.

The executive sponsor will be the one communicating the move to
Google Apps to all of your users by signing his or her name on the
company announcement or even recording a video message to all
employees.

The result: Executive buy-in and commitment for resources to support
your change management strategy.
